Without teeth, it is difficult for the elderly to meet their nutritional needs. Old age is not easy. Older people must deal with multiple physical and mental health challenges. One of the biggest challenges is losing your teeth. Teeth are related to food and food provides all the necessary nutrients for the body. No tooth limits your options, but this does not mean that you should compromise on nutrition.

There are some soft foods that can be given to the elderly. These foods are also very nutritious, which is a beneficial situation for the family. Here are five of those foods.

Scrambled eggs

Eggs are notorious for raising cholesterol levels in the elderly. But eggs are rich in protein, which can help build muscle. Not only that, eggs are also rich in nutrients, including vitamin D, vitamin B12, choline, and selenium. You can make scrambled eggs simply by using egg whites to control cholesterol levels.

Smoothies

The shakes not only look great, they are also rich in nutrients. Smoothies are very useful for older people because they are rich in fruits and vegetables and you can enjoy them without even chewing them. You can use fruits and vegetables, such as bananas, strawberries, and spinach, for health benefits. If the elderly digest well, you can add a tablespoon of protein powder.

Oatmeal

Oatmeal is easy to prepare and healthy to eat, making it a favorite breakfast choice for many people. Oatmeal is rich in nutrients, has a smooth taste, and is easy to eat. A serving of oatmeal contains four grams of fiber. You can add some raisins, flax seeds, and walnuts to make your oatmeal healthier. You can also make them delicious by adding vegetables.

Yogurt

Yes, yogurt is a food in itself. It is an important source of calcium, protein, and potassium. It also contains probiotics, which can keep the digestive tract healthy and help fight any yeast infections.
